"Nobody asked for this!" - players opposed the remaster of Horizon Zero Dawn

Today information has emerged about the age rating of the remaster of Horizon: Zero Dawn, which was originally released on PlayStation 4 in 2017. Although Sony has not yet decided to make an official announcement, it is only a matter of time, as there have already been reports of a new version of Aloy's adventure.

Sony has again faced enormous criticism. The topic of PS5 Pro and the lack of a drive is still hot, and now there is news about a remaster of a game that doesn't really need it. At least according to a significant part of the community.

Players are making it clear that they would prefer another project that is more deserving of a remaster or even a remake. Horizon: Zero Dawn has become the butt of jokes, just like the current policies of the Japanese corporation. Let us remind you that Horizon runs on PS5 at 60 FPS.

The remaster of Horizon: Zero Dawn is scheduled for release on PS5 and PC. At the moment we are waiting for the official presentation from Sony.
